The CMHZ5222B TR belongs to the category of semiconductor components, specifically a Zener diode.
It is commonly used for voltage regulation and protection in electronic circuits.
The CMHZ5222B TR is typically available in a small surface-mount package.
The essence of this product lies in its ability to maintain a constant voltage across its terminals, making it suitable for various electronic applications.
It is usually supplied in reels or tubes, with quantities varying based on manufacturer specifications.
The CMHZ5222B TR typically has two pins, with the anode and cathode identified for proper orientation.
The CMHZ5222B TR operates based on the principle of the Zener effect, where it maintains a nearly constant voltage drop across its terminals when reverse biased.
This component finds application in various electronic circuits, including: - Voltage regulators - Power supplies - Overvoltage protection circuits
